KEY TAKEAWAYS
Energy and Seasons
There is an acknowledgment of the lack of energy at the start of the new calendar year despite societal expectations to implement new things. Spring is seen as a more natural time for renewal and new beginnings as things come back to life and animals emerge.
Holistic Approach to Health
The importance of viewing health seasonally and holistically is emphasized, considering the body, environment, and food together.
Five Elements Theory:
The five elements (earth, fire, wood, metal, water) and their connection to different organs, emotions, and seasons are discussed. For example, the liver is associated with wood and spring, which correlates with irritability.
Personality and Elements:
Personalities and characteristics can be understood through the five elements. For instance, certain traits, body types, and sounds can help determine someone's element and how to treat them accordingly.

Western vs. Eastern Medicine:
The integration of Western and Eastern medicine is considered beneficial. Western medicine provides quick solutions and diagnostic capabilities, while Eastern medicine offers holistic and root cause treatments. Both approaches have their place and should ideally work in harmony.
Advocating for One's Health:
Individuals need to advocate for their own health and well-being, seeking the best treatment plans and not relying solely on quick fixes. Consistency in following prescribed treatment plans is crucial, whether from Western or Eastern practitioners.
